5speed swap car wont start (not cracking over)
Posted: Sun Sep 02, 2007 2:03 am
by awdwagon
Hi
So i just finished the 5 speed swap in my 1991 turbo legacy and i cant get the car to crank over?? any ida's thanks guys
Posted: Sun Sep 02, 2007 2:25 am
by Splinter
A bit more info would be useful
Chances are, you didnt hook up the neutral start switch to the clutch pedal, so the ECU thinks the car is in gear, thus wont activate the starter.
Posted: Sun Sep 02, 2007 3:36 am
by awdwagon
ok im reading the wrightup where the heck is my inhibitor switch located?
Posted: Wed Sep 05, 2007 6:07 pm
by Legacy777
The inhibitor switch is in the AT tranny.
Don't hook the neutral switch up to the clutch pedal. It goes to the ECU.
If you read my write-up, you should be able to figure out what you need to do to get the car running, even if you don't put in the clutch start switch.
